Sorry you are having problems.

It sounds like something has become corrupt on your machine. It migth be worth checking it for errors/viruses etc and do a general health check to make sure nothing is wrong.

It looks like the installer has failed to write or delete a file. This sounds like an HD issue. It might be worth trying to install to a new folder and see if that helps. It is unlikely to be an issue with teh disk as it woudl not generate this type of error. It woudl produce a read eerror. If there is a write/delete error it is on the HD side, not the CD side as it never attempts to write/delete anything to the CD.

If you have not already try rebooting and doing it again. PC's can be a real pain like this sometimes.
